Honestly, I didn't think Ole Henriksen's Pout Preserve Peptide Lip Treatment could get any cooler. The formula—brimming with nourishing Scandinavian cloudberry seed oil, peptides (duh), kokum butter, and wild mango butter—already has a cult following on TikTok thanks to its easy glide and ability to boost collagen, plump lips with hydration, and smooth fine lines. Celeb endorsements from Suni Lee and Alix Earle (plus Bing herself) certainly don't hurt, and neither does a yummy flavor-tint combo; the TikTok crowd can't get enough of Crème Brûlée, Cocoa Crème, and Strawberry Sorbet.

Bing's limited-edition collab features the latter flavor with a mauve-pink pigment and shimmering finish. It's the brand's first glimmer shade, meant to celebrate their shared Scandinavian heritage and a commitment to self-love. (The tube reads "I love me," meant to evoke micro-moments of joy—a glimmer of light, if you will.)
